**Ticket #—: SeatScribe vault locked out**

Hey support folks — the config vault for the SeatScribe renderer (the thing that draws seat maps for the Bellwether Playhouse) locked itself after three bad attempts during last night's deploy. Rendering still works from cache, but we can't push the new balcony layout. Per runbook, unlock it with the recovery passphrase noted directly below.

unlock words, tagaf-hahif: ralwyn-lammir-rusax-sormir

## Authentication

The Banneret consent-banner rollout tool authenticates against the Permiflow policy service before pushing any banner config. Requests without valid credentials are rejected and logged. For staged rollouts, the release manager uses a scoped key with deploy-only permissions. The current deploy key is shown below.

API key for yahig-tadup: kto7_ubizbYm

Ticket: Partition config drift on Shardwell plugins

Several third-party plugins create monthly partitions using hardcoded boundaries instead of reading the shared scheme, causing drift between environments. Effective next release, Shardwell will reject partitions whose month boundaries don't match the canonical calendar config, and auto-creation runs two months ahead. Plugin authors should drop any local partition logic and consume the published settings instead. For reference, the canonical values currently deployed are:

settings of bafof-fajog:
[aldix]
port = 9300
region = north-3
host = aldix.kelvilabs.example
team = istath
timeout_ms = 1500
retries = 8